Abstract
Aiming at the problem of concurrent operation of multi-program control instruments in automatic test systems, the asynchronous socket communication method is used to measure and control effectively. The asynchronous task object is used to measure and control the TCP socket of the multi-program control instrument, and the Async and Await methods are used to improve the control efficiency of the program control instrument and the friendliness of the software. The research ideas and implementation methods are proposed. This method solves the concurrency control problem of the program control equipment well and improves the running speed and stability of the test system.
